A COD 3PL (third-party logistics provider specializing in cash-on-delivery) handles the operational complexity that makes COD e-commerce viable in Latin America. For international merchants—particularly those from MENA, Asia, or North America entering LATAM—COD 3PLs provide local infrastructure without requiring physical presence, legal entities, or on-the-ground teams.
A COD 3PL specializes in handling cash-on-delivery operations, adding services beyond standard logistics:
Standard 3PL
- Warehousing and storage
- Pick, pack, and ship
- Carrier integration
- Inventory management
COD 3PL Adds
- Order confirmation (voice/call center)
- COD cash collection
- Reconciliation and settlements
- RTO management
- Cross-border compliance support
- Local Warehousing: Products stored locally for reasonable delivery times
- Order Confirmation in Local Language: Spanish voice confirmation (Portuguese for Brazil)
- Multi-Carrier Delivery Network: No single carrier covers all LATAM effectively
- COD Collection and Reconciliation: Systematic tracking of cash
- International Settlements: Payouts in USD or home currency
- Merchant of Record (MoR) Support: For merchants without local entities

What is a COD 3PL?
A COD 3PL is a third-party logistics provider that specializes in cash-on-delivery operations. Beyond standard warehousing and shipping, COD 3PLs integrate order confirmation, cash collection, reconciliation, and merchant settlements.
